The differences between the Imaging Programs?
Basically, features. But theres also other things such as how well the compress the Image.
For example, Lets say all your DATA is on 1 single Hard drive, and you have your images on a external, or even a secondary Internal.
If you were to accidently delete something, (lets say the entire My Pictures folder) you may be required to completely restore the entire Image to get them back.
I think this is how Win7s will behave. (Please correct me if wrong)
Others, that offer more features and are more flexible will allow you to browse the contents of the Image, and restore selective files or folders. In this case the entire Pictures folder, or just a Image.
Im not that familiar with macrium so Im unsure if it allows this.
Some are only capable of Imaging partitions, others can do, not only partitions, but the entire disc (including the reserved 100MB partition) and restore it all in 1 go including the disk signature.
Additionally, some may offer other features such as Incremental, Differential backups, Automatic Scheduling.
Also, you will not be limited to just creating Images of a drive, but can also set schedules for Backups of target areas. Perhaps just the documents folder or Videos etc.
